ARMOR:
-B.A.M.F. Rear Diff Skid
-B.A.M.F. Sliders w/Kick Out
-ATO Front IFS Skid
-BruteForce HC Tube Bumper w/Swing Down Tire Carrier
-Budbuilt Gas Tank Strap
-Pelfreybuilt Aluminum Gas Tank Skid
-Pelfreybuilt Hybrid Front Bumper

SUSPENSION:
FRONT:
-King Racing 8 x 2.5 Coilovers w/ Remote Res
-Dirt Designs 4wd Race Long Travel Kit
-Wheelers Super Bump-stops
-Total Chaos Shocks Tower Gussets
-Total Chaos Alignment Tab Gussests


REAR:
-DMZ SUA Long Travel Kit
-Infamous Metal Works Bed Cage
-Boxed Frame w/New Cross-members
-Deaver LT Springs + AAL
-King Racing 16" 2.5 Triple Bypass Shocks w/ Remote Resi's
-Bay Area Metal Fab ( B.A.M.F. ) Outer Frame Gussets
-Fox 2.0 Air Bumps 2" Travel
-Poly-Performance Air Bump Mounts
-18" Limit Straps

RECOVERY:
-SmittyBilt XRC-8 8000k COMP Winch(Synthetic Rope & Aluminum Fairlead)
-SmittyBilt Recovery Kit w/ Snatch Block, Tree Saver, Chain
-SmittyBilt Recovery Strap 2 x 20ft
-SmittyBilt Element Ramps
-Hi-Lift Xtreme 48" Jack
-Hi-Lift Base
-SmittyBilt Snatch Strap
-Smittybilt Recovery Strap
-ARB Winch Extension Strap
-Factor 55 FlatLink

DRIVE-TRAIN:
-ARB Rear Air Locker
-ARB High Vol Air Compressor w/Air Line Kit
-Rear Diff Breather Extension/Relocation Mod
-ARB Front Locker
-G2 4.56 Front & Rear Gears
-JD Rear Diff Crush Bushing Eliminator Kit
-B&M Trans Cooler

EXTERIOR:
-Cut Rear Fender
-GrillCraft Grille
-Glassworks 4" Wide 3" rise Fenders


LIGHTING:

-OKLedLightbars.com 40" Double Row LED Bar
-OKLedLightbars.com 20" Double Row LED Bar
-OKLedLightbars.com 3" LED Spot Lights x 2
-OkLedLightbars.com Rock Lights x 6
-OkLedLightbars.com Rock Lights on bed rack x 4
-B.A.M.F. Behind the Grill Light Mount
-Depo OEM BHM leadlights
-CBI off road Ditch Light Brackets


WHEELS/TIRES:
-Hankook DynaPro M/T 35x12.5x17 ( x 5 )
-SCS SR8 Matte/Gloss Black [ 17 x 8 / 0 Offset / 4.5 BS ] ( x 5 )
-SpiderTrax 1.25 Wheel Spacers Rear

INTERIOR:
-WeatherTech Floor Liners F & R
-Illuminated 4 x 4 switch
-Salex Glove Box & Console Organizers
-Tech Deck Mount
-Ram Phone Mount
-Ram Tablet Mount
-Blue Ridge Overland Gear Seat Molle Panel
-Blue Ridge Overland Gear Visor Molle Panel


ELECTRONICS:
-Yaesu Dual Band Ham Radio
-Cobra 40 Channel CB Radio
-Firestik 4ft Fiberglass Whip Ant.
-Scangauge Ultra II
-Blue Sea 12 Slot Fuse Block
-HiFonics Components F & R
-DVRyourcar.com Car DVR system
-Otattw switches & covers

ENGINE:
-TRD Supercharger
-TRD Intake System w/ AFe Filter
-Doug Thorley Shorty Headers
-MBRP Catback Turn Down Exhaust



BRAKES:
-EBC Extra Duty Pads
-EBC Slotted/Dimpled Rotors
-Goodrich Stainless Brake Lines Front
-All Pro Extended Brake Lines Rear


MISC:
-EZ Lift TailGate Shock
-Redline Hood Shocks
-B.A.M.F. Fuse Block Mount
-2 RotoPax 2 Gal Gas Carriers
-2 RotoPax 2 Gal Water Carrier w/Bed Mount
-20lb C02 air system
-Wheelers c02 155 psi regulator
-Wheelers 20# Mount
-Wheelers 20' Coiled Hose
-VIAIR 0-200psi Regulator

STORAGE:
-B.A.M.F. Custom Bed Rack ( w/swing out arm for shower )
-PrinSu Aluminum Low Profile Roof Rack
-Rubber Maid Action Packers
-Bed Slide 1000CL


OFF ROAD GEAR:
-ARB 6.5ft Retractable Awning
-ARB Mosquito Netting for Awning
-TruckFridge.com 40L Fridge/Freezer ( Indel B ) [ page 21 ]
-ARB Fridge Tie Downs [ page 21 ]
-Ironman 4x4 Fridge Insulated Cover [ page 21 ]
-Custom Built Fridge Slide [ page 21 ]
-Tepui Roof Top Tent
